Overview of FANUC CNC Machines
FANUC CNC machines integrate high-performance hardware and software to automate complex machining tasks. FANUC, a pioneer in CNC technology originating from Japan, stands synonymous with innovation and excellence. With over 5 million CNCs installed globally, their systems are known for delivering unmatched reliability and performance.

Technical Specifications of FANUC CNC Machines
Feature | Description |
---|---|
Control System | FANUC CNC control systems (30i, 31i, 32i) |
Axes | 3, 4, or 5-axis configurations available |
Tool Change Time | As low as 0.7 seconds for ROBODRILL models |
Maximum Speed | Varies by model; up to 60,000 RPM for spindles |
Connectivity | IIoT compatible, supports various data exchange protocols |
Energy Consumption | Designed for optimal energy efficiency |
